In-situ oil shale retorting. Energy efficiency evaluation.

    Experts from the company INFOCOM ASIA collaboratively with Shvartsman L.Z., a corresponding member of the Academy of Engineering Sciences and Bazhenov Y.V., candidate of engineering sciences, developed and patented a new efficient method of shale gas production with the use of method of in-situ oil shale retorting by resistive arc heating of the oil shale beds by thermozoned sections (TZ-RA method).

    A new method of resistive arc heating of the oil shale formation has a wide range of benefits in comparison with other widely applied methods of shale gas production, such as fracking and ex-situ retorting.

    It will be recalled that fracking is a method of hydraulic fracturing with the application of chemical agents on the large territories and intensive shattering of formations with environmentally unfriendly impact as a result. Besides, this method of shale gas production is very expensive. For information, from experience of USA, infrastructure development of one well costs $ 2,6 - 4 million dollars. In addition, 3-4 hydraulic fracturing operations are performed on each well every year (each operation costs $250 thousand dollars).

    Although another method of above-ground oil shale processing using the in-situ retorting method allows comparing economic efficiency of oil shale and coal of high quality, from the viewpoint of experts of INFOCOM ASIA this method has disadvantages, caused by environmental problem of waste rock utilization and economic constraints with increasing depth of workable formations and expenses for delivery of raw materials to the place of processing.

    So the search of more efficient, environmentally friendly and cheap technology is preferred. More and more arguments show the efficiency of the in situ retorting method. Technology of in-situ oil shale retorting by resistive arc heating of the oil shale formations by thermozoned sections doesn’t have disadvantages of other methods: starting capital investments and time for production of marketable product are reduced; process of oil shale extraction is simplified. The characteristic property of this method is the possibility of creation of the restricted thermozoned area inside the formation, which parameters can be optimized by calculation according to the thickness and depth of the working formation, thermophysical properties of oil shale and surrounding rock massif. Possibility of control of moving speed of working zone allows controlling temperature gradient inside the working zone, and therefore the reaction spreading velocity.

    The additional advantage of this method is possibility of its adaptation towards thin shale formations, deep-lying formations and quick production of marketable products with high index of energy efficiency of oil shale production
